    Specs:
    42mm Oystercase, 904L
    (18k)Whitegold, fluted Rolesor Ring-Command Bezel
    Oyster bracelet, 3-link
    Folding Oysterclasp, 5mm Easy-Link
    Sapphire crystal + Cyclops lense
    Screwed down Twinlock crown
    100m water resistence
    Calibre 9001
    72h power reserve
    -2/+2 accuracy
    Annual calendar complication
    Second Timezone / GMT
